Global Thermally Conductive Adhesives Market Set for Significant Growth Through 2033
The Thermally Conductive Adhesives Market is witnessing substantial expansion driven by the increasing demand for efficient thermal management in electronics and automotive applications. These adhesives play a critical role in dissipating heat in high-performance devices, making them essential in sectors like consumer electronics, automotive, aerospace, and industrial equipment.
The market is experiencing growth due to the rise in miniaturization of electronic devices. As devices become smaller, effective heat dissipation becomes crucial, driving the adoption of thermally conductive adhesives over traditional thermal interface materials. Their ability to improve device longevity and performance is further fueling demand globally.
Innovation in materials is also a key growth driver. Advanced formulations that offer higher thermal conductivity and enhanced mechanical strength are being developed, supporting the expansion of the market in high-end applications.

Market Dynamics and Trends
Thermally conductive adhesives are broadly categorized into epoxy-based, silicone-based, and acrylic-based adhesives. Epoxy-based adhesives dominate the market due to their high thermal conductivity, chemical resistance, and mechanical strength. Silicone-based adhesives are gaining popularity for their flexibility and stability at high temperatures.
The electronics sector remains the largest end-user, accounting for over 45% of total market demand in 2024. Smartphones, laptops, and LED lighting systems increasingly incorporate thermally conductive adhesives to manage heat and improve performance. The automotive sector, particularly EVs, is emerging as a high-growth segment, expected to grow at a CAGR of over 9% during the forecast period.
Advanced adhesive formulations with nano-fillers, such as boron nitride and aluminum oxide, are improving thermal conductivity while maintaining electrical insulation, opening new possibilities in high-performance applications.

Technological Advancements Driving Market Growth
The market is witnessing rapid technological advancements aimed at improving thermal conductivity, adhesion strength, and reliability under extreme conditions. Emerging innovations include:
-
Nano-composite adhesives: Enhance thermal conductivity while maintaining low viscosity for easy application.
-
High-temperature resistant adhesives: Suitable for EV powertrains and aerospace electronics operating in extreme conditions.
-
Eco-friendly formulations: Focus on reducing volatile organic compounds (VOCs) and meeting regulatory compliance for sustainable manufacturing.
As industries continue to adopt these advanced adhesives, the demand for high-performance thermally conductive solutions is expected to grow exponentially over the next decade.

Market Value and Forecast
The global thermally conductive adhesives market was valued at approximately USD 3.1 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ach around USD 5.5 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 6.5%. Growth is supported by rising demand from electronics, automotive, and renewable energy sectors. The market size is further expanded by technological innovations, regulatory incentives, and increasing industrial automation.
Epoxy-based adhesives are anticipated to retain the largest market share due to their superior thermal performance. Silicone-based adhesives are projected to register the highest growth rate, given their flexibility and performance in high-temperature applications.
